Biography
1 May 1972, Houston, Texas, USA. One of the leading figures to emerge from the new Texas country music scene in the mid-to-late 90s, singer-songwriter and guitarist Morrows brand of good-time country rock has earned him a huge audience in his home state. Morrow began playing guitar while at high school but did not take his future vocation seriously until he began attending concerts while studying at Texas Tech in Lubbock. He quit school in 1993 and relocated to Austin, where the Cory Morrow Band built up a strong reputation on the bar circuit. The self-released Texas Time Travelling EP sold nearly 5, 000 copies, inspiring Morrow to record an album with his band. The follow-up album, 1998s The Man That Ive Been, was recorded with musicians from Jerry Jeff Walkers band.
